Red air jordan 1 : After wearing these for a day, my honest review- they crease [ef2i4ppd]
It happens fast right on the toe box. That's the nature of this leather and design. Some hate it, I think it adds character. The red still looks brilliant, and the overall structure holds up. Just don't expect them to stay pristine if you're actually walking around. That's part of the journey with a Jordan 1. From an aesthetic angle, this shoe is a 10/10 for me. The red Air Jordan 1 is just pure, undiluted sneaker history. On feet, it has that perfect, slightly-taller profile that I love. The upside is unparalleled heritage and style. The downside? It's a common silhouette, so it's not "unique." If you're looking for something rare and exclusive, this general release might not satisfy that itch, despite its beautiful color. Alright, guys, opening this box... the red Air Jordan 1 is "just" iconic. The leather feels decent – not the "best" ever, but it's solid for the ~$170 price point. That "University Red" against the black and white? Timeless. It looks even better in hand than in pictures, honestly. It's a piece of sneaker history, right here. Final thoughts, guys. This shoe earns its keep in my closet. The Red Air Jordan 1 delivers exactly what it promises: iconic looks & solid construction. Pros: Timeless style, great for outfits, durable build. Cons: Stiff comfort initially, prone to creasing. It's not trying to be something it's not. If you understand & want that classic Jordan 1 experience, you'll be happy. Just manage your expectations on the foot feel!
